Application Information



ERAS web site logoWe accept applications only through ERAS (Electronic Residency Application Service). Paper applications will not be reviewed.

We conduct interviews from November through January. For the match please keep in mind appropriate deadlines. It is strongly encouraged to open an ERAS account as soon as possible and complete your application by the first of October.

On the interview day, applicants will have the opportunity to talk with current residents over a continental breakfast, interview with four faculty members, tour the institution, and enjoy lunch with a few of the residents at a local restaurant.

Minimum Requirements for Application

    1. Applications are accepted only through ERAS (paper applications will not be reviewed)
    2. Application deadline: October 1, 2009
    3. Applicants must have passed USMLE Step 1. Successful applicants have scores of 220 or higher
    4. Three letters of recommendation as well as the Dean’s letter are required
    5. Less than 3 years since medical school graduation
    6. Mandatory clinical internship in either internal medicine, pediatrics, surgery or its subspecialties, obstetrics and gynecology, neurology, family practice, emergency medicine, or an ACGME or equivalent accredited transitional year.
    7. IMG Additional Requirements: J-1 Visa ECFMG Certified
